#dcf496 h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#dcf496 is composed of 86.3% red, 95.7% green and 58.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 9.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 38.5% yellow and 4.3% black. It has a hue angle of 75.3 degrees, a saturation of 81% and a lightness of 77.3%. #dcf496 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#b9e92d. Closest websafe color is: #ccff99.

● #dcf496 color description : Very soft green.
The hexadecimal color #dcf496 has RGB values of R:220, G:244, B:150 and CMYK values of C:0.1, M:0, Y:0.39, K:0.04. Its decimal value is 14480534.

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010200 is the darkest color, while #fafdef is the lightest one.

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#c6c7c3 is the less saturated color, while #e0fd8d is the most saturated one.
